Italy is a captivating country that is famous for its arts and culture. Not forgetting the magnificent and historical monuments that have been in existence since 70-80 A.D. The country is made out of flat plains covered with mountain ranges. Depending on the latitude, the weather differs in different parts of Italy. The weather up north is harsher with a frigid cold during winters and extreme heat during the summer as opposed to the south region.
Italy is ranked as the fifth top-visited country in the world, with approximately 63.2 million tourists a year. Blessed with remarkable architecture and arts centres, we have derived the top three places to visit in Italy, which are Milan, Rome and Venice.
Home to some of the major and luxurious fashion brands in the world, Milan is the most popular fashion hub in the world. While shopping is a must in Milan, there are also other monuments worth visiting such as the 15th-century castle.
Rome is packed with historical monuments that have been around since the Roman empire. The most famous attractions are the Pantheon, Trevi Fountain and Colosseum. You should try out their pizzas and gelatos too while you are there.
Queen of the Adriatic or better known as Venice, is a city in Italy that is famous for its grand canals and waterways. This romantic place can be quite packed during the peak seasons, so be prepared.

Though the country has four seasons, it is best to adhere to the travelling seasons that are divided into three categories. The peak begins from mid-June to August, shoulder season from April to mid-June and September to October. Lastly, off-peak seasons from November to March.
During the peak seasons you will be expecting higher travel and accommodation fares, but it is the best time to visit Italy as it is the driest during these months. The days are also longer enabling you more time to tour the country.
Shoulder months are great too for those who have the flexibility to travel out of the school terms. The weather is nice and warm enough for you to hit the beaches and admire the blooming flowers during Spring.
It is best to avoid travelling to Italy from November to March as the weather tends to be unpredictable with heavy downpours in freezing temperature. The plus point is there will be no crowd in the museums during these times.

It is easy to navigate around Italy, whether you are interested in staying in one city or tour around. The public transportation system is easy to understand and comfortable to move around major cities. Rent a car if you have an additional budget or hop on a bus for a more cost-saving option. The only downside is that the bus schedules can be tricky to understand, and it only travels to limited places. For interstate travels, flying will be a better option, but it is best to book as early as possible for a cheaper fare.
